My Buying Guides on Latex Travel Pillow Gray
Why I Chose a Latex Travel Pillow
When I started looking for a travel pillow, I wanted something that felt supportive but still comfortable for long trips. A latex travel pillow stood out to me because it offers a good balance of firmness and softness. I found that latex helps keep my neck in a better position, especially when I’m sitting for hours on a plane, train, or car ride.
Why the Gray Color Matters to Me
I also liked the gray color because it feels simple, clean, and easy to match with my other travel items. For me, gray is a practical choice since it doesn’t show dirt as quickly as lighter colors. It also gives the pillow a more modern and understated look, which I personally prefer.
What I Look for in Comfort
Comfort is the first thing I check. I want a pillow that supports my neck without feeling too stiff or too bulky. Latex has worked well for me because it gently adapts to my shape while still keeping its structure. I also pay attention to whether the pillow feels breathable, since I don’t like feeling hot during travel.
Support and Neck Alignment
One of the biggest reasons I choose a latex travel pillow is support. I need something that helps reduce strain on my neck and shoulders. When I use a well-shaped pillow, I notice I arrive feeling less tired and less sore. I always look for a design that keeps my head from tilting too far to one side.
Size and Portability
Since I travel often, I want a pillow that is easy to carry. I prefer a compact size that fits into my bag without taking up too much space. If the pillow comes with a travel pouch or can be compressed easily, that is a big plus for me. Portability matters because I don’t want to add extra hassle to my trip.
Cover Material and Cleanliness
I always check the pillow cover before buying. A soft, removable, and washable cover is important to me because I want to keep my travel gear fresh. Since I use my pillow in different places, I appreciate a cover that feels gentle on my skin and is easy to clean after a trip.
Durability and Quality
I look for a latex travel pillow that feels well made and durable. I want something that keeps its shape over time and doesn’t flatten quickly. In my experience, a good-quality latex pillow lasts longer and gives me better value for my money. I also check stitching, material quality, and overall finish.
Things I Consider Before Buying
Before I make a purchase, I think about:
- How much neck support I need
- Whether the pillow feels too firm or too soft
- How easy it is to pack and carry
- Whether the cover is washable
- If the gray shade matches my travel style
- How durable the pillow seems
